site stats

Dataframe append row python

WebMar 30, 2024 · I have the following DataFrame data with random index values: A B 100 0 7 203 5 4 5992 0 10 2003 9 8 20 10 5 12 6 2 I would like to add a new column 'C' with row numbers. For example: A B C 100 0 7 0 203 5 4 1 5992 0 10 2 2003 9 8 3 20 10 5 4 12 6 2 5 WebApr 18, 2024 · then some of the index values will be greater than the size of the dataframe, and the accepted answer may overwrite an existing row. In that case, I recommend: row …

How to Read CSV Files in Python (Module, Pandas, & Jupyter …

WebApr 10, 2024 · Each row of the df is a line item for an order. If an order contains fruit, I need to add a row for a "fruit handling charge", e.g.: Input DF: Order Item Is_Fruit 100 Apple TRUE 100 B... Webpd.DataFrame converts the list of rows (where each row is a scalar value) into a DataFrame. If your function yields DataFrames instead, call pd.concat. It is always cheaper to append to a list and create a DataFrame in one go than it is to create an empty DataFrame (or one of NaNs) and append to it over and over again. philly is in pennsylvania https://summermthomes.com

Pandas高级操作,建议收藏(二)_骨灰级收藏家的博客-CSDN博客

WebDec 29, 2015 · How do I append only one row to a new dataframe? I have only seen examples appending a whole dataframe. I am using iterrows to so I have the index of … WebNov 17, 2013 · I would like to append a string to the start of each value in a said column of a pandas dataframe (elegantly). ... (python 3.6.4): df = pd.DataFrame({'col':['a', 0]*200000}) %timeit df['col'].apply(lambda x: f"str{x}") 117 ms ± 451 µs per loop (mean ± std. dev. of 7 runs, 10 loops each) %timeit 'str' + df['col'].astype(str) 112 ms ± 1.04 ms ... WebDataframe to a list of all row values. The goal here is to change the dataframe into a list of lists with each individual list containing the values of a single row. To convert a dataframe to a list of row values use df.values.tolist() where df is the dataframe you want to convert. Let’s look at an example. tsb btl criteria

Append a New Row in a Dataframe in Python

Category:python - Fill a new pandas column with row numbers - Stack Overflow

Tags:Dataframe append row python

Dataframe append row python

Append existing excel sheet with new dataframe using python …

WebApr 10, 2024 · Pandas高级操作,建议收藏(二). 骨灰级收藏家 于 2024-04-10 15:39:55 发布 267 收藏. 分类专栏: python pandas 数据分析 文章标签: pandas python 数据分析 数据处理 数据分析师. 版权. python 同时被 3 个专栏收录. 57 篇文章 4 订阅. 订阅专栏. pandas. 3 篇文章 1 订阅. WebAug 30, 2024 · Method #1. Add a pandas Series object as a row to the existing pandas DataFrame object. # Create a pandas Series object with all the column values passed as …

Dataframe append row python

Did you know?

WebYou can append one row or multiple rows to an existing pandas DataFrame in several ways, one way would be creating a list or dict with the details and appending it to … WebThe syntax of DataFrame.append () method is. df = df.append (new_row, ignore_index=True) Try Online. where df is the DataFrame and new_row is the row …

WebOct 8, 2024 · Read: Python Pandas replace multiple values Adding new row to DataFrame in Pandas. In this program, we will discuss how to add a new row in the Pandas … WebMar 11, 2024 · The append() method, when invoked on a dataframe, takes a python dictionary as its input argument and appends the values of the dictionary to the …

WebAug 29, 2024 · Method 3. The third method is an effective way of appending rows to the dataframe. Note: DataFrame.append () or Series.append () has been depreciated since the version 1.4.0. So, if you want to use the latest version, you need to use this method. To concat two dataframe or series, we will use the pandas concat () function. WebJan 11, 2024 · Python is a great language for doing data analysis, primarily because of the fantastic ecosystem of data-centric python packages. Pandas is one of those packages …

WebJul 28, 2024 · There are different methods to achieve this. Now let’s see with the help of examples how we can do this. Example 1: We can add a single row using …

WebThe reset_index (drop=True) is to fix up the index after the concat () and drop_duplicates (). Without it you will have an index of [0,1,0] instead of [0,1,2]. This could cause problems for further operations on this dataframe down the road if it isn't reset right away. Can also use ignore_index=True in the concat to avoid dupe indexes. tsb bsb codeWebHere’s an example code to convert a CSV file to an Excel file using Python: # Read the CSV file into a Pandas DataFrame df = pd.read_csv ('input_file.csv') # Write the DataFrame to an Excel file df.to_excel ('output_file.xlsx', index=False) Python. In the above code, we first import the Pandas library. Then, we read the CSV file into a Pandas ... tsb breakdownWebApr 7, 2024 · Insert a Dictionary to a DataFrame in Python. We will use the pandas append method to insert a dictionary as a row in the pandas dataframe. The append() method, when invoked on a pandas dataframe, takes a dictionary containing the row data as its input argument. After execution, it inserts the row at the bottom of the dataframe. philly jawn shirtsWebAug 24, 2024 · Thanks for helping me realise this. Problem is you need assign back appended DataFrame, because pandas DataFrame.append NOT working inplace like pure python append. It seem you want append to list, so parameter ignore_index=True is not necessary: houseitems = [] for data in datum: print (data.text) print (data.get ('href')) df = … tsb brouster gate east kilbrideWebApr 13, 2024 · Surface Studio vs iMac – Which Should You Pick? 5 Ways to Connect Wireless Headphones to TV. Design tsb bromley branchWebDefinition and Usage. The append () method appends a DataFrame-like object at the end of the current DataFrame. The append () method returns a new DataFrame object, no changes are done with the original DataFrame. tsb branch witneyWebExample 1: Append New Row at Bottom of pandas DataFrame. In this example, I’ll explain how to append a list as a new row to the bottom of a pandas DataFrame. For this, we … tsb btl product transfer